Wards & Effects: Vision is Power in Dota 2

Vision is arguably the most crucial resource in Dota 2. Without adequate vision, teams are blind to enemy movements, making them susceptible to ganks, ambushes, and objective pushes. Wards are the primary tools for establishing and maintaining this vital vision, providing invaluable information that can dictate the flow of the entire game. Understanding where and when to place wards, and what their effects are, is a fundamental skill for any successful player.

Wards are consumable items that, when placed on the map, grant vision in a radius around them. They are essential for controlling the map, securing objectives, and preventing surprise attacks. There are two main types of wards: Observer Wards and Sentry Wards, each serving a distinct but equally important purpose. Observer Wards: The Eyes of the Map

  • Purpose: Observer Wards provide unobstructed vision of an area, revealing both enemy and allied heroes, creeps, and buildings. They are invisible to the enemy unless detected by Sentry Wards or other detection methods.
  • Placement: Ideal locations for Observer Wards include high ground areas, common jungle paths, Roshan pit, and key intersections that overlook important areas of the map. Placing them in 'power runes' spots is also critical.
  • Duration: Observer Wards last for six minutes before expiring.
  • Cost: They are relatively inexpensive, making them a staple for supports.

Sentry Wards: The Hunters of Stealth

  • Purpose: Sentry Wards are also invisible to the enemy but have a much smaller vision radius. Their primary function is to detect and reveal invisible units and wards.
  • Placement: Sentry Wards are crucial for dewarding enemy Observer Wards, revealing invisible heroes like Riki or Bounty Hunter, and detecting illusions. They are often placed directly on top of enemy Observer Wards or in areas where invisible heroes are suspected to be.
  • Duration: Sentry Wards last for four minutes.
  • Cost: They are slightly more expensive than Observer Wards.

Other Forms of Vision and Detection

Beyond basic wards, Dota 2 offers other ways to gain vision and detect enemies:

  • Gem of True Sight: A valuable item that grants true sight (reveals all invisible units and wards) to its carrier. If the carrier dies, the Gem is dropped and can be picked up by the enemy.
  • Dust of Appearance: A consumable item that, when used, reveals all invisible units in an area around the caster for a short duration.

Strategic Ward Placement and Dewarding

Effective warding is an art form. Supports are typically responsible for warding, but all be aware of vision needs.

  • Early Game: Wards are crucial for lane control, securing runes, and preventing early ganks.
  • Mid Game: Warding around Roshan, key jungle entrances, and objectives like towers becomes paramount.
  • Late Game: Deep warding into the enemy jungle can provide critical information for pickoffs and objective pushes.
  • Dewarding: Actively hunting and destroying enemy wards with Sentry Wards or detection items is as important as placing your own. Denying vision to the enemy is a significant advantage.
